Facile synthesis of graphene oxide/palygorskite composites for Pb(II) rapid removal from aqueous solutions
As a kind of earth-abundant and cheap natural clay mineral, palygorskite (Pal) was facilely modified by grafting with graphene oxide (GO) to fabricate GO/Pal composites for rapid removal of Pb(II) from aqueous solutions.
